Most men would probably consider paying €2,285 for a casual jacket an extravagance, but some might, just might, think it's a bargain. It's out in the market Not too long ago, this one anyway, although similar but less sophisticated versions had been out in some exclusive shops for a while.

The jacket in question is designed for the Brand name Ermenegildo Zegna, "Bluetooth iJacket ", modern but with a "washed out" vintage look, according to the advertisement. The pockets are equipped with mechanisms that facilitate music and mobile phone all at once, with a control on the sleeve and another on the collar. 

When the phone rings, the volume of the music automatically drops to alert you of the call and the control device changes it's function to mobile.
Two more pockets are incorporated, one for the phone, and a transparent one for the iPod.

Other details feature leather-trimmed collar, lightly quilted, fastening loops for microphones and earphone. In two colours, light and dark brown.
